Attempt on Trump: 'Azov' commented on rumors about connections with the suspect.


The 'Azov' brigade denied any connection with the suspect in the attempt on Trump.
We officially declare that Ryan Wesley Ruth has no connection to 'Azov' and never had any relationship with the brigade. The peaceful demonstration he attended was open, and anyone could join it. He appeared in the video shot by the protesters by accident
Spreading the narrative of a possible connection between Ruth and the 'Azov' brigade helps Russian propaganda and discredits the National Guard of Ukraine.
Yesterday, it became known that an attempt was made near Trump. He is safe. According to Trump, “Shots were heard near me. Before rumors get out of control, I want you to hear this first: I am safe and sound! Nothing will stop me. I will never give up. I will always love you for supporting me”.
The FBI considers this incident a possible attempt on Trump's life. The US Secret Service confirmed that its agent opened fire on the armed suspect.
The suspect in the assassination attempt is Ryan Wesley Ruth. During his arrest, he was found with two backpacks and a GoPro camera, and an AK-47 rifle was found near the scene of the incident. In 2022, Ruth went to Ukraine to participate in the war against Russia as part of the 'Foreign Legion'.
This is the second attempt on Trump's life this year. Previously, on July 13, he suffered an ear injury at a rally in Butler.
The International Legion of the Armed Forces of Ukraine also denied any connection with Ruth and noted that he did not recruit fighters.
